Thanks Christoph for the backtrace. I am unable to reproduce it, but
looking at your backtrace, I found a bug. Would you be able to give it a
try and check if it fixes the problem?

diff --git a/image/main.c b/image/main.c
index 58dcecb..0158844 100644
--- a/image/main.c
+++ b/image/main.c
@@ -550,7 +550,7 @@ static void sanitize_name(struct metadump_struct
*md, u8 *dst,
                return;
        }

-       memcpy(eb->data, dst, eb->len);
+       memcpy(eb->data, src->data, src->len);

        switch (key->type) {
        case BTRFS_DIR_ITEM_KEY:
